Tissue Phantom equipment is a type of imaging technology used to simulate the properties of human tissue. It is used in medical research, medical imaging, and medical device testing. Tissue Phantom equipment is designed to replicate the physical, chemical, and optical properties of human tissue, allowing researchers to accurately test and evaluate medical devices and imaging systems. The equipment typically consists of a tissue phantom, a light source, and a detector.
